Preobrazhenskii Sobor (Cathedral of the Transfiguration)

Petro The brightly-lit and bright yellow Cathedral of the Transfiguration was built by decree of empress Elizabeth on the same location where the Preobrazhenskii (Transfiguration) Regiment's Grenadier Company Palace had been. Built between 1743 and 1754. In 1825, the building burned down and was rebuilt between 1827-29, using the original walls, under the guidance of architect V.P. Stasov in classical style. It is dedicated to the military victory in the Turkish campaign of 1828-29. The cathedral is surrounded by a fence made from captured Turkish guns.
